Why is treatment sometimes done earlier than the payment?
When a case is urgent and vital, hospitals often proceed with delivering medical care right away to save a life, even before the finalisation of admission procedures. Usually, when this happens, hospitals put the bill on our credit until the funds are transferred to their accounts. That’s why the chronology can sometimes be in disorder.

About infections
Plasmodium falciparum is the type of malaria that most often causes severe and life-threatening malaria in a patient.

Background
Yusuf is a 8 y.o. boy, a primary 2 student in a public school who lives with his relatives in a 4-room house. Yusuf stays in a room with the other 9 kids. He likes sweets and chocolates and also, he likes riding a bicycle, playing with toys, and playing soccer. The boy is suffering from plasmodiasis and enteric fever. His family has no source of income that could cover his medical expenses. Prior to presentation to UMD Hospital and Helpster Charity the boy was taken to a traditional herbalist and received some medication due to paucity of fund but proved futile as the condition isn’t improving.
Medical history
The child was admitted on the 17th of May 2023, and treated for acute Malaria and Typhoid fever and later discharged on the 22nd of May.
Prognosis
The patient was presented to our facility with fever, fatigue, vomiting, dizziness, anorexia and a headache. The patient was diagnosed with Acute Plasmodiasis and Enteric Fever. If not treated immediately, can lead to life threatening complications.
